The Planet Group
https://cdn.haleymarketing.com/templates/63515/logos/square.png
http://www.theplanetgroup.com
http://www.theplanetgroup.com
true
Internal Communications Specialist
770 Cochituate Road Framingham, MA 01701 US
Posted: 01/15/2025
2025-01-15
2025-02-18
Employment Type:
Contract To Hire
Job Category: Marketing
Job Number: 628050
Country: United States
Is job remote?: Yes
Job Description
Internal Communications Specialist
Location: Fully remote
Duration: 12 months
Pay: up to $35.00/hr, DOE
Our retail client has a need for an Internal Communications Specialist. This contract role will be for 12 months and has a high probability of converting into a full-time position. This role is fully remote.
The Internal Communications Specialist is responsible for creating and implementing internal communications strategies and materials for the Company's global associates across IT. In this highly collaborative and creative role, this person must have the ability to plan and develop business communications, internal announcements, meeting presentations, marketing collateral, scripts, event logistics, and branded materials to drive business priorities forward. The Internal Communications Specialist is responsible for Internal Communications team support and the planning and execution of associate-facing communication deliverables in partnership with internal business groups. By using defined processes and partnering with various content owners and teams, this person would plan for, support, and help implement multi-channel internal communications efforts.
Responsibilities:
Qualifications:
Location: Fully remote
Duration: 12 months
Pay: up to $35.00/hr, DOE
Our retail client has a need for an Internal Communications Specialist. This contract role will be for 12 months and has a high probability of converting into a full-time position. This role is fully remote.
The Internal Communications Specialist is responsible for creating and implementing internal communications strategies and materials for the Company's global associates across IT. In this highly collaborative and creative role, this person must have the ability to plan and develop business communications, internal announcements, meeting presentations, marketing collateral, scripts, event logistics, and branded materials to drive business priorities forward. The Internal Communications Specialist is responsible for Internal Communications team support and the planning and execution of associate-facing communication deliverables in partnership with internal business groups. By using defined processes and partnering with various content owners and teams, this person would plan for, support, and help implement multi-channel internal communications efforts.
Responsibilities:
- Gather content and draft/edit associate-facing communications such as memos, articles, presentations, and marketing collateral
- Develop visuals based on requirements and aligned to brand standards
- Draft communications plans for Associate-facing campaigns
- Track communications deliverables using centralized tool
- Advise partners in the business on communications tools and processes
- Develop and implement small-scale associate-facing communications campaigns and provide support on large-scale campaigns
- Support creation of weekly associate newsletter
- Maintain intranet sites, including the drafting and posting of content, managing permissions, formatting pages, and keeping up to date
- Assist with internal event planning and logistics
Qualifications:
- 3-8 years of experience in Communications or Marketing
- Microsoft Office and strong PowerPoint skills (required)
- Strong verbal, written, and visual communication skills, as well as interpersonal skills
- Strong creative skills such as graphic design, marketing, etc.
- Ability to distill complex technical concepts into digestible and easy to understand formatting
- Attention to detail and ability to prioritize work to meet deadlines, while maintaining confidentiality
- Interest and ability to optimize digital communications tools
- Preferred technology skills: SharePoint, Microsoft Lists, Poppulo, photo editing
- Bachelor’s degree in Communications, Marketing or equivalent work experience
Share This Job:
Related Jobs:
Login to save this search and get notified of similar positions.About Framingham, MA
Ready for an exciting career in the vibrant community of Framingham, Massachusetts? Explore our job opportunities in this dynamic area that boasts rich history, stunning landscapes, and a thriving economy. Framingham is nestled in Middlesex County, just west of Boston, offering a perfect blend of urban conveniences and suburban charm. With landmarks like the Framingham History Center, amazing local cuisine ranging from classic New England fare to global flavors, and venues like the Amazing Things Arts Center and MetroWest Symphony Orchestra, Framingham is a hub of culture and creativity. Join the bustling job market, take advantage of top-notch education and healthcare facilities, and immerse yourself in the welcoming community spirit of Framingham. Let's kickstart your career journey together!